Book of short stories written by
Rick Moody, published in 1995 originally, but now, there's a pretty
paperback version out on
Warner Books. As you would expect from Moody, the stories are exceptionally
creepy. The first story is about a
jilted lover who becomes more and more obsessed with his
faithless wife, to the point of jogging with tapes of his wife's and
lover's conversations. While it doesn't get any weirder than that, it never really veers in to
light-hearted comedy. The title refers to the cast of characters in the title
novella. It's uneven - but this is quite a nice book.
